Arguably moroccan rug one of the most beloved of many of the Moroccan rugs, Beni Ourain rugs have an unmatched mutability owing to their neutral palette and especially dense and downy wool (courtesy of substantial altitude-dwelling sheep herds). Whereas most Moroccan rugs skew maximalist, Beni Ourain rugs are marvelously minimalist. They normally feature a thick-woven white or product-coloured pile adorned with a simple black or brown crisscrossing diamond style.

The patterns, colors and products useful for building rugs fluctuate by area and explain to regional stories. Large sheep wool rugs, warm inside the winter, are popular in mountain spots. Camel and agave rugs are fantastic in warmer climates including the desert parts of Morocco and utilized by the Taureg (or Touareg) folks, An additional common tribe residing in the desert areas of Morocco.
